Hillsdale, Mi vs Port Elizabeth Climate & Distance Between

South Africa flag
  • The distance between Hillsdale, Mi, Usa and Port Elizabeth, South Africa is approximately 14,035 km or 8,722 mi.
  • To reach Hillsdale, Mi in this distance one would set out from Port Elizabeth bearing 300.4°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Hillsdale, Mi bearing 285.8° or WNW .
  • Hillsdale, Mi has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Port Elizabeth has a Mediterranean warm climate (Csb).
  • Hillsdale, Mi is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Port Elizabeth is in or near the subtropical thorn woodland biome.
  • The average temperature is 9.2 °C (16.5°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 19.6 °C (35.3°F) more in Hillsdale, Mi.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 430.3 mm (16.9 in) more which is equivalent to 430.3 l/m² (10.56 US gal/ft²) or 4,303,000 l/ha (460,019 US gal/ac) more. About 1 4/5 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 7.3° lower in Hillsdale, Mi than in Port Elizabeth.
